William Vas Obituary

April 25, 1941 - November 29, 2019 Son, Brother, Father, & Grandfather
Survived by Son Michael "Norman", Grandchildren Johnathon, Allie, & James
He was happiest with a fishing rod in his hand or at the controls of a boat.
Bill was a Life Long Beach Boy, in love with the ocean. In addition to fishing and boating, he enjoyed swimming, playing water polo, surfing both board and body, skin and scuba diving, and bicycling. He could often be seen riding his beach cruisers up and down the Newport Beach Boardwalk.
He retired from Long Beach Fire Department in 1995 after 33 years Serving as a Firefighter, Engineer, and Fire Boat Operator during the course of his career.
As a U.S. Coast Guard licensed Boat Captain for more than 50 years he ran dozens of Sportfishing, Charter, Tug boats, & Commercial Fishing vessels along with numerous private Yachts from Alaska to Costa Rica, through the Panama Canal, and across the Gulf of Mexico and Caribbean.
Bill loved the Southern California waters and spent much of his life boating and fishing along our coastline. Sharing his love of the ocean gave him great pleasure. He served as the President of the Balboa Angling Club and was a lifetime member there. He was active in the Pacific Fisheries Enhancement program, that breeds, raises, and releases thousands of White Sea Bass in our local waters and was the volunteer coordinator for the grow out facility and pens in Newport Harbor for several years. For decades he was a volunteer deck hand on board the annual introduction to fishing charter trips hosted by the Balboa Angling Club for underprivileged kids and took great pride in sharing his knowledge and experience with the children he encountered on those trips and his travels.
